Triumphs, Track Toll, and Physical Resilience
Nadia Battocletti’s rapid ascent to the top of world distance running has been defined by heroic tactical races and incredible endurance. Following her historic performances on the global stage, including her silver-medal triumph in the 10,000 meters at the Paris Games and her double gold at the European Athletics Championships, her racing calendar has been exceptionally demanding. However, elite long-distance training pushes the human immune system to its absolute limits, making world-class runners particularly susceptible to sudden viral illnesses and systemic fatigue.
Health management is an ongoing challenge for elite distance specialists. Over recent seasons, minor viral infections and respiratory setbacks have occasionally forced Battocletti to alter her competition schedule or withdraw from late-stage training camps. In elite athletics, competing through a fever or an unaddressed viral load carries severe risks, including long-term cardiorespiratory fatigue or overtraining syndrome. Her coaching team, led by her father and former elite runner Giuliano Battocletti, has consistently prioritized long-term career health over short-term race appearances, ensuring that any reported illness is treated with immediate rest and thorough diagnostic evaluations.
Medical Protocols, Public Updates, and Broadcast Coverage
Whenever concerns regarding a potential battocletti illness surface, the Italian Athletics Federation (FIDAL) initiates a standard diagnostic protocol. This involves comprehensive blood panels, immunological assessments, and physiological tracking to determine whether symptoms stem from acute infections or standard high-volume training fatigue.
- Diagnostic Testing: Comprehensive health screening to rule out underlying infections, viral strain, and iron deficiencies.
- Load Reduction: Immediate shift to active recovery or low-impact cross-training until key inflammatory markers normalize.
- Event Decisions: Final participation calls made within 48 to 72 hours of scheduled race starts to safeguard athletic health.
